The Do’s And Don’ts After Water Damage
Water provides life, water intrusion on parts where it's not supposed to be can result in damage. It can peel away surfaces as well as deteriorate the structure if the water saturates right into your structure. Mold as well as mildew additionally thrive in a moist setting, which can be unsafe for your wellness. Residences with water damages scent old and musty.

Water can come from several resources such as tropical storms, floods, burst pipes, leakages, as well as sewage system concerns. In case you experience water damages, it would be good to know some safety preventative measures. Right here are a few standards on how to manage water damage.

Do Prioritize House Insurance Protection



Water damages from flood dues to hefty winds is seasonal. However, you can likewise experience a sudden flooding when a defective pipeline instantly bursts into your house. It would certainly be best to have residence insurance policy that covers both acts of God such as natural tragedies, and emergencies like damaged plumbing.

Don't Fail To Remember to Switch Off Utilities



This reduces off power to your whole residence, preventing electrical shocks when water comes in as it is a conductor. Do not fail to remember to turn off the major water line shutoff.

Do Remain Proactive and Heed Weather Condition Informs



Storm floodings can be really unpredictable. If there is a background of flooding in your neighborhood, stay aggressive and also prepared. Listen to discharge warnings if you live near a river, lake, or creek . Obtain prized possessions from the first stage and also cellar, then placed them on the highest possible degree. Doing so decreases potential residential or commercial property damages.

Don't Disregard the Roofing System



You can avoid rain damages if there are no holes and leakages in your roofing system. This will protect against water from moving down your walls and saturating your ceiling.

Do Focus On Tiny Leakages



A ruptured pipe does not take place overnight. You may discover bubbling paint, peeling off wallpaper, water streaks, water discolorations, or dripping audios behind the wall surfaces. Have your plumbing repaired prior to it results in enormous damages.

Don't Panic in Case of a Ruptured Pipeline



Keeping your presence of mind is vital in a time of crisis. Since it will certainly suppress you from acting quickly, panicking will only intensify the problem. When it comes to water damage, timing is vital. The longer you wait, the more damage you can anticipate. Hence, if a pipeline bursts in your residence, immediately shut off your main water valve to cut off the source. After that disconnect all electric outlets in the area or shut off the circuit breaker for that part of your home. Lastly, call a trusted water damages remediation specialist for help.

When are Water Mitigation Services Needed?




Water intrusion can come from small sources like a dishwasher leak or larger ones like rainwater causing inches of standing water in a basement. Other instances of damage that call for water mitigation services include:



  • Sewer backup, sump pump failure, or clogged toilets


  • Toilet wax seal failure


  • Shower pan corrosion


  • Pipe leaks and ruptures


  • Washer or icemaker line breaks


  • HVAC drain line blockage


  • A leaking roof


  • Moisture behind walls


  • Foundation cracks


  • Mold


  • Mold is a good example to illustrate how water mitigation works. We’ve often found that clients we do mold remediation services for had existing water damage issues that ended up leading to the mold damage. When performing water mitigation we look for what’s causing the water problem and for ways to stop mold before it multiplies and becomes a bigger concern.



    Are You Currently Experiencing a Water Disaster?




    If you’re in the middle of a water intrusion disaster, here are some important dos and don’ts to follow:



    Don’ts:



  • Safety first! Do not enter a room with standing water until the electricity has been turned off!


  • A regular household vacuum should never be used to pick up water.


  • Never use electrical appliance if standing on a wet floor or carpet.


  • Leave visible mold alone.


  • Dos:



  • Call a water mitigation professional as soon as possible. Mold and other damage can begin within hours of a water intrusion.


  • Mop and blot up as much water as possible.


  • Remove non-attached floor coverings and mats but leave wall-to-wall carpeting removal to a pro.


  • If there are window coverings like draperies that touch the water, loop them through a hanger and put them up on the rod.


  • Remove wet cushions to dry and wipe down soaked furniture.


  • Move valuables like paintings, photos, and art objects to a dry location. Books should be left tightly packed on shelves until it’s determined if they need specialized drying.


  • Prop open closets, cabinets, and drawers to allow them to air out.
